Title:
BICYCLE PARKING FACILITY EXIT CONTROL SYSTEM
Document Type and Number:
Japanese Patent JP3214324
Kind Code:
B2
Abstract:
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To efficiently and most properly control a bicycle parking facility unmanned.
SOLUTION: A charge settler 1, a pair of sensors 2A, 2B for wheel part detection provided with prescribed intervals in the front and back of this charge settler 1, an automatic opening and closing gate and a car model discrimination device are arranged at an exit passage in a bicycle parking facility. A car model actuating a pair of the sensors 2A, 2B for wheel part detection is discriminated by the car model discrimination device under prescribed working conditions of a pair of the sensors 2A, 2B for wheel part detection, a charge previously set in correspondence with an ordering ticket or a prescribed card input in a prescribed input port of the charge settler 1 and a discriminated car model by the car model discrimination device is computed and displayed on the charge settler 1, when a charge displayed on this charge settler 1 is paid in a prescribed payment port, the automatic opening and closing gate is opened, and after the automatic opening and closing gate is opened, it is closed under prescribed conditions. In the meantime, this constitution is made subject to various kinds of deformation in accordance with use conditions.
